1. Spice It Up:
Instead of relying solely on chili powder for heat, try adding a diced jalapeno or a dash of cayenne pepper. You can even experiment with different types of chili peppers, like poblano or chipotle, for a unique flavor profile. Remember, start small and gradually add more spice until you reach your desired level of heat.
2. Creamy Dreamy:
Swap out the usual heavy cream for a lighter option, like low-fat milk or even unsweetened almond milk. You can also add a dollop of Greek yogurt or a spoonful of mascarpone cheese for a tangy twist. For a dairy-free version, use coconut milk for a rich and creamy texture.

3. The Power of Beans:
Don’t limit yourself to just white beans. Experiment with different types, like black beans, pinto beans, or even chickpeas. Each variety brings a unique flavor and texture to your chili. You can even try using a combination of beans for a more complex and satisfying dish.
4. Veggie Boost:
Sneak in some extra vegetables for added nutrition and flavor. Diced carrots, zucchini, or corn kernels are great options. You can even roast them beforehand for a smoky flavor that adds depth to your chili.
5. Flavor Bomb:
Take your chili to the next level with a flavor bomb. This is a simple mixture of ingredients that you can add towards the end of cooking to enhance the taste. A classic flavor bomb for white chicken chili includes lime juice, cilantro, and a pinch of cumin.
6. Make It a Meal:
Instead of serving your chili on its own, make it a complete meal by adding some toppings. Shredded cheese, sour cream, diced avocado, and tortilla chips are classic choices. You can also try crumbled bacon, sliced jalapenos, or even a fried egg for a more adventurous twist.
7. Leftover Magic:
Don’t let leftover chili go to waste! Use it to create a delicious new dish, like chili mac and cheese, chili nachos, or even chili stuffed peppers. You can also freeze it for later and enjoy a quick and easy meal on a busy weeknight.
8. Crock-Pot Convenience:
If you’re short on time, let your slow cooker do the work. Simply combine all of your ingredients in the pot and let it simmer for several hours. The result will be a flavorful and tender chili that’s perfect for a cozy dinner.
9. One-Pot Wonder:
Save on dishes by cooking your chili in one pot. Start by sautéing the onions and garlic, then add the rest of the ingredients and let it simmer until everything is cooked through. This method is not only convenient, but it also helps to develop deeper flavors as the ingredients cook together.
10. DIY Spice Blend:
Create your own custom spice blend for a unique flavor profile. Combine chili powder, cumin, oregano, garlic powder, and onion powder in a jar and shake it up. Use this blend to season your chili and other dishes for a consistent and delicious taste.
11. Quick and Easy:
If you’re really short on time, there are plenty of shortcuts you can take. Use rotisserie chicken instead of cooking your own, or opt for canned beans instead of dried. You can even find pre-made chili seasoning mixes at the grocery store. Just be sure to read the label and choose a mix that fits your dietary needs and preferences.
